I have the greatest respect for golfers and tennis players. In what other sport could athletes govern themselves in competition? Well, high school competition, anyway. John McEnroe might not have been very fun to play against.

It was with particular relish that I read about Santa Margarita and Mater Dei, and the incident involving Monarch golfer Arianna Kjos, if it could really be called an incident. According to the Register, the matter ended up moot, but it reiterates the ideal that in some arenas, it’s how you play the game.
